COURSE TUITION, ROOM, AND BOARD

The fees for tuition and room and board are $2,500 and include all books, reading materials, a course USB, and field trips. See below for information on accommodation and meals.

ACCOMMODATIONS AND MEALS

Lodging:
On-campus accommodations will be dorm style with a private bedroom and a shared bathroom. SMDP Students will stay in the UNH Fairchild Hall dormitory( provides traditional residence hall-style housing. Common areas include a recreation lounge, three small study lounges, as well as a kitchen and laundry facilities.The building has air conditioning and is centrally located in the heart of downtown Durham. There are hotel options within walking distance, but prices are considerably more expensive than on-campus accommodations. If you stay off campus, there will be a discount of $325from full Tuition/Room and Board fees for non-residential (commuter) students. While housing will not be provided, all meals described below will be included.
Meals:
The SMDP will provide three meals per dayfrom dinner onSaturday, June 20th through breakfast on Sunday, June 28th. We will hold a closing banquet and certificate ceremony for all students and faculty on Saturday,June 27th. All other meals are the responsibility of students; there are several options both on and off campus for restaurant meals and a full service supermarket with takeout food.

Refund Information:

If you cannot attend the SMDP, you may request a refund in writing or via email. Requests received before May 31, 2015, will be refunded in full, less a $100 processing fee. There will be no refunds for cancellations received after that date. It can take up to 4 weeks after the end of the SMDP-NH CERTIFICATE 2015 for your refund to be processed. The refund will be remitted in the form it was received. For example, credit card payments will be issued a credit back to the original card the charge was made on (due to credit card regulations we are unable to make exceptions to this policy), and wire transfers will be refunded via wire.

United States Visa Information

The visitor visa is a type of non-immigrant visa for persons desiring to enter the United States temporarily for business (B-1) or for pleasure, tourism, or medical treatment (B-2). For how-to apply information, documentation requirements, and more, see the following links:

Please note:The U.S. visa process can be quite lengthy.It is strongly advised that you begin the visa application process once you have been accepted to attend the SMDP-NH Certificate.
